Responsibilities
In your role as a Clinical Night Manager at HC-One, you will:
* Deliver the highest standard of care by assessing nursing needs and identifying the right interventions for residents who need you.
* Supervise colleagues, manage shifts, and ensure flawless handover summaries to maintain continuity of care.
* Oversee a team and, in the Home Manager\'s absence, lead the team and run the home.
* Support colleagues to develop their performance, administer prescribed medicines, and prepare incident reports with resident wellbeing at the core.
* Promote residents\' independence, choice, dignity and respect by delivering the best standards of care and seeking continuous improvement.
* Ensure the physical, emotional and social needs of residents are met.
* Mentor and share knowledge as a practice supervisor and assessor to students.
* Demonstrate effective communication, both verbally and in writing, and model professional behaviours.
* Advocate a person-centred approach to care for residents and their families.
* Safeguarding is everyone\'s responsibility; recognise signs of abuse, harm or neglect and know what actions to take. Attend safeguarding training and escalate concerns as appropriate.
